Tom Chilton leads twice aborted warm-up in Marrakech

RML Chevrolet Tom Chilton led a 1-2 in the morning warm-up session at Morocco, which was twice red flagged. The session was ended prematurely after a heavy crash for Special Tuning Racing’s Tom Boardman at Turn 5.

The short 15 minute session was held in cool conditions with a lifting fog. The red flag was out in less than a few minutes after Nika Racing’s Michel Nykjaer spun around at the chicane at Turn 14 after setting the fastest first sector in the Chevrolet Cruze.

When the session resumed, Tom Chilton soon jumped to the top of the time sheets in the RML Chevrolet ahead of the two Chevrolets of team-mate Yvan Muller and bamboo-engineering’s James Nash.

Tom Boardman set the fourth fastest time overall in the STR SEAT León WTCC, but then on the following lap appeared to suffer with a technical problem heading into Turn 7 whilst behind Alex MacDowall’s Chevrolet, and crashed into the wall at full speed. The session was red flagged with just over three minutes to go and not resumed.
